You could measure the volume the head to determine your CR.

 

I seem to remember that the pockets in the pistons measure something like 2.8cc and you can measure the piston to deck height.

 

That way you could work out exactly what needs skimming for your desired CR. This would be my approach, if working on my own engine (I learned the hard/expensive way).

 

Alternatively, conventional wisdom suggests that a skim could be in order after some material removal from the combustion chamber.

If the gasket face is in good unmarked condition I would be reluctant to skim the head. In any case .010" is not going to make a lot of difference to the C/r. On the first K head that I ported I did not skim the head following work unshrounding the valves and cleaning up the combustion chambers. It was a standard head fitted with 29.5mm inlet and 26 mm exhausts, 285M or 740 cams and standard pistons on a 1600cc it made 186bhp. The engine is pictured LF and on Dave Andrews web site. The head was later sold to Dave Jackson who fitted 1227 cams and accralite pistons to increase CR it made a stonking 206 bhp out of 1600cc. Dave won the 2003 L7 speed championships with this engine.

Dave,

 

Assuming

Head comb chamber vol = 31.5cc

 

Bore= 8cm

Stroke = 8.93cm

Displaced Vol = 448.9cc

 

Gasket thickness = 0.15cm

Gasket bore = 8.2cm

Gasket Vol = 7.92cc

 

Piston - deck height = 0.2cm

Piston - Deck Vol = 10.1cc

 

Piston Pocket Vol = 2.8cc

 

CR = (31.5 + 448.9 + 7.92 + 10.1 + 2.8) / (31.5 + 7.92 + 10.1 + 2.8)

CR = 9.6:1

 

If you take 10thou off your head = 0.0254cm

This is about 1~1.3cc;

 

Therefore, with a 10thou skim (assuming 1cc);

 

CR = (31.5 + 448.9 + 7.92 + 10.1 + 2.8 - 1) / (31.5 + 7.92 + 10.1 + 2.8 - 1)

CR = 9.7:1

 

There may well be a flaw in the calculation and it depends on your piston-deck height, the pocket volume of your pistons and the volume in your head but it looks about right to me.
